Skip to main content
Top

2018 | OriginalPaper | Chapter

A Security-Driven Approach to Online Job Scheduling in IaaS Cloud Computing Systems

Authors : Jakub Gąsior, Franciszek Seredyński, Andrei Tchernykh

Published in: Parallel Processing and Applied Mathematics

Publisher: Springer International Publishing

Activate our intelligent search to find suitable subject content or patents.

search-config
loading …

Abstract

The paper presents a general framework to study issues of multi-objective on-line scheduling in the Infrastructure as a Service model of Cloud Computing (CC) systems taking into account the aspects of the total work-flow execution cost while meeting the deadline and risk rate constraints. Our goal is providing fairness between concurrent job submissions by minimizing tardiness of individual applications and dynamically rescheduling them to the best suited resources. The system, via the scheduling algorithms, is responsible to guarantee the corresponding Quality of Service (QoS) and Service Level Agreement (SLA) for all accepted jobs.

Dont have a licence yet? Then find out more about our products and how to get one now: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Literature
1.
go back to reference Ali, M., Khan, S.U., Vasilakos, A.V.: Security in cloud computing: opportunities and challenges. Inf. Sci. 305, 357–383 (2015)MathSciNetCrossRef Ali, M., Khan, S.U., Vasilakos, A.V.: Security in cloud computing: opportunities and challenges. Inf. Sci. 305, 357–383 (2015)MathSciNetCrossRef
2.
go back to reference Benoit, A., Marchal, L., Pineau, J.-F., Robert, Y., Vivien, F.: Scheduling concurrent bag-of-tasks applications on heterogeneous platforms. IEEE Trans. Comput. 59(2), 202–217 (2010)MathSciNetCrossRefMATH Benoit, A., Marchal, L., Pineau, J.-F., Robert, Y., Vivien, F.: Scheduling concurrent bag-of-tasks applications on heterogeneous platforms. IEEE Trans. Comput. 59(2), 202–217 (2010)MathSciNetCrossRefMATH
3.
go back to reference Buyya, R., Abramson, D., Giddy, Í.: Nimrod/G: an architecture for a resource management and scheduling system in a global computational grid. In: Proceedings of the Fourth International Conference/Exhibition on High Performance Computing in the Asia-Pacific Region (HPC Asia 2000), pp. 283–289. IEEE Computer Society Press (2000) Buyya, R., Abramson, D., Giddy, Í.: Nimrod/G: an architecture for a resource management and scheduling system in a global computational grid. In: Proceedings of the Fourth International Conference/Exhibition on High Performance Computing in the Asia-Pacific Region (HPC Asia 2000), pp. 283–289. IEEE Computer Society Press (2000)
4.
go back to reference Buyya, R., Yeo, C.S., Venugopal, S., Broberg, J., Brandic, I.: Cloud computing and emerging IT platforms: vision, hype and reality for delivering computing as the 5th utility. Future Gener. Comput. Syst. 25(6), 599–616 (2009)CrossRef Buyya, R., Yeo, C.S., Venugopal, S., Broberg, J., Brandic, I.: Cloud computing and emerging IT platforms: vision, hype and reality for delivering computing as the 5th utility. Future Gener. Comput. Syst. 25(6), 599–616 (2009)CrossRef
5.
go back to reference Calheiros, R.N., Ranjan, R., Beloglazov, A., De Rose, C.A.F., Buyya, R.: CloudSim: a toolkit for modeling and simulation of cloud computing environments and evaluation of resource provisioning algorithms. Softw. Pract. Exp. 41(1), 23–50 (2011)CrossRef Calheiros, R.N., Ranjan, R., Beloglazov, A., De Rose, C.A.F., Buyya, R.: CloudSim: a toolkit for modeling and simulation of cloud computing environments and evaluation of resource provisioning algorithms. Softw. Pract. Exp. 41(1), 23–50 (2011)CrossRef
6.
go back to reference Celaya, J., Marchal, L.: A fair decentralized scheduler for bag-of-tasks applications on desktop grids. In: 2010 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ing (CCGrid), pp. 538–541, May 2010 Celaya, J., Marchal, L.: A fair decentralized scheduler for bag-of-tasks applications on desktop grids. In: 2010 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ing (CCGrid), pp. 538–541, May 2010
7.
go back to reference Chang, V.: The business intelligence as a service in the cloud. Future Gener. Comput. Syst. 37, 512–534 (2014). Special Section: Innovative Methods and Algorithms for Advanced Data-Intensive Computing. Special Section: Semantics, Intelligent Processing and Services for Big Data. Special Section: Advances in Data-Intensive Modelling and Simulation. Special Section: Hybrid Intelligence for Growing Internet and its ApplicationsCrossRef Chang, V.: The business intelligence as a service in the cloud. Future Gener. Comput. Syst. 37, 512–534 (2014). Special Section: Innovative Methods and Algorithms for Advanced Data-Intensive Computing. Special Section: Semantics, Intelligent Processing and Services for Big Data. Special Section: Advances in Data-Intensive Modelling and Simulation. Special Section: Hybrid Intelligence for Growing Internet and its ApplicationsCrossRef
8.
go back to reference Chang, V.: Towards a big data system disaster recovery in a private cloud. Ad Hoc Netw. 35, 65–82 (2015). Special Issue on Big Data Inspired Data Sensing, Processing and Networking TechnologiesCrossRef Chang, V.: Towards a big data system disaster recovery in a private cloud. Ad Hoc Netw. 35, 65–82 (2015). Special Issue on Big Data Inspired Data Sensing, Processing and Networking TechnologiesCrossRef
9.
go back to reference Chang, V., Kuo, Y.-H., Ramachandran, M.: Cloud computing adoption framework: a security framework for business clouds. Future Gener. Comput. Syst. 57, 24–41 (2016)CrossRef Chang, V., Kuo, Y.-H., Ramachandran, M.: Cloud computing adoption framework: a security framework for business clouds. Future Gener. Comput. Syst. 57, 24–41 (2016)CrossRef
10.
go back to reference Chang, V., Walters, R.J., Wills, G.B.: Organisational sustainability modelling-an emerging service and analytics model for evaluating cloud computing adoption with two case studies. Int. J. Inf. Manag. 36(1), 167–179 (2016)CrossRef Chang, V., Walters, R.J., Wills, G.B.: Organisational sustainability modelling-an emerging service and analytics model for evaluating cloud computing adoption with two case studies. Int. J. Inf. Manag. 36(1), 167–179 (2016)CrossRef
11.
go back to reference de Assunção, M.D., Buyya, R.: Performance analysis of multiple site resource provisioning: effects of the precision of availability information. In: Sadayappan, P., Parashar, M., Badrinath, R., Prasanna, V.K. (eds.) HiPC 2008. LNCS, vol. 5374, pp. 157–168. Springer, Heidelberg (2008). https://doi.org/10.1007/978-3-540-89894-8_17 CrossRef de Assunção, M.D., Buyya, R.: Performance analysis of multiple site resource provisioning: effects of the precision of availability information. In: Sadayappan, P., Parashar, M., Badrinath, R., Prasanna, V.K. (eds.) HiPC 2008. LNCS, vol. 5374, pp. 157–168. Springer, Heidelberg (2008). https://​doi.​org/​10.​1007/​978-3-540-89894-8_​17 CrossRef
12.
go back to reference Gąsior, J., Seredyński, F.: A Sandpile cellular automata-based scheduler and load balancer. J. Comput. Sci. 21(Suppl. C), 460–468 (2017)CrossRef Gąsior, J., Seredyński, F.: A Sandpile cellular automata-based scheduler and load balancer. J. Comput. Sci. 21(Suppl. C), 460–468 (2017)CrossRef
13.
go back to reference Jansen, W.A.: Cloud hooks: security and privacy issues in cloud computing. In: Proceedings of the 2011 44th Hawaii International Conference on System Sciences, HICSS 2011, pp. 1–10. IEEE Computer Society, Washington, DC (2011) Jansen, W.A.: Cloud hooks: security and privacy issues in cloud computing. In: Proceedings of the 2011 44th Hawaii International Conference on System Sciences, HICSS 2011, pp. 1–10. IEEE Computer Society, Washington, DC (2011)
14.
go back to reference Kolodziej, J., Khan, S.U., Wang, L., Kisiel-Dorohinicki, M., Madani, S.A., Niewiadomska-Szynkiewicz, E., Zomaya, A.Y., Xu, C.-Z.: Security, energy, and performance-aware resource allocation mechanisms for computational grids. Future Gener. Comput. Syst. 31, 77–92 (2014)CrossRef Kolodziej, J., Khan, S.U., Wang, L., Kisiel-Dorohinicki, M., Madani, S.A., Niewiadomska-Szynkiewicz, E., Zomaya, A.Y., Xu, C.-Z.: Security, energy, and performance-aware resource allocation mechanisms for computational grids. Future Gener. Comput. Syst. 31, 77–92 (2014)CrossRef
15.
go back to reference Modi, P.J., Shen, W.-M., Tambe, M., Yokoo, M.: Adopt: asynchronous distributed constraint optimization with quality guarantees. Artif. Intell. 161(1–2), 149–180 (2005)MathSciNetCrossRefMATH Modi, P.J., Shen, W.-M., Tambe, M., Yokoo, M.: Adopt: asynchronous distributed constraint optimization with quality guarantees. Artif. Intell. 161(1–2), 149–180 (2005)MathSciNetCrossRefMATH
16.
go back to reference Nesmachnow, S., Perfumo, C., Goiri, I.: Controlling datacenter power consumption while maintaining temperature and QoS levels. In: 2014 IEEE 3rd International Conference on Cloud Networking (CloudNet), pp. 242–247, October 2014 Nesmachnow, S., Perfumo, C., Goiri, I.: Controlling datacenter power consumption while maintaining temperature and QoS levels. In: 2014 IEEE 3rd International Conference on Cloud Networking (CloudNet), pp. 242–247, October 2014
17.
go back to reference Raycroft, P., Jansen, R., Jarus, M., Brenner, P.R.: Performance bounded energy efficient virtual machine allocation in the global cloud. Sustain. Comput.: Inform. Syst. 4(1), 1–9 (2014) Raycroft, P., Jansen, R., Jarus, M., Brenner, P.R.: Performance bounded energy efficient virtual machine allocation in the global cloud. Sustain. Comput.: Inform. Syst. 4(1), 1–9 (2014)
18.
go back to reference Viswanathan, S., Veeravalli, B., Robertazzi, T.G.: Resource-aware distributed scheduling strategies for large-scale computational cluster/grid systems. IEEE Trans. Parallel Distrib. Syst. 18(10), 1450–1461 (2007)CrossRef Viswanathan, S., Veeravalli, B., Robertazzi, T.G.: Resource-aware distributed scheduling strategies for large-scale computational cluster/grid systems. IEEE Trans. Parallel Distrib. Syst. 18(10), 1450–1461 (2007)CrossRef
19.
go back to reference Singh, G., Kesselman, C., Deelman, E.: A provisioning model and its comparison with best-effort for performance-cost optimization in grids. In: Proceedings of the 16th International Symposium on High Performance Distributed Computing, HPDC 2007, pp. 117–126. ACM, New York (2007) Singh, G., Kesselman, C., Deelman, E.: A provisioning model and its comparison with best-effort for performance-cost optimization in grids. In: Proceedings of the 16th International Symposium on High Performance Distributed Computing, HPDC 2007, pp. 117–126. ACM, New York (2007)
20.
go back to reference Song, S., Hwang, K., Kwok, Y.-K.: Risk-resilient heuristics and genetic algorithms for security-assured grid job scheduling. IEEE Trans. Comput. 55(6), 703–719 (2006)CrossRef Song, S., Hwang, K., Kwok, Y.-K.: Risk-resilient heuristics and genetic algorithms for security-assured grid job scheduling. IEEE Trans. Comput. 55(6), 703–719 (2006)CrossRef
21.
go back to reference Tchernykh, A., Lozano, L., Bouvry, P., Pecero, J.E., Schwiegelshohn, U., Nesmachnow, S.: Energy-aware on-line scheduling: ensuring quality of service for IaaS clouds. In: 2014 International Conference on High Performance Computing Simulation (HPCS), pp. 911–918, July 2014 Tchernykh, A., Lozano, L., Bouvry, P., Pecero, J.E., Schwiegelshohn, U., Nesmachnow, S.: Energy-aware on-line scheduling: ensuring quality of service for IaaS clouds. In: 2014 International Conference on High Performance Computing Simulation (HPCS), pp. 911–918, July 2014
22.
go back to reference Tchernykh, A., Lozano, L., Schwiegelshohn, U., Bouvry, P., Pecero, J.E., Nesmachnow, S., Drozdov, A.Y.: Online bi-objective scheduling for IaaS clouds ensuring quality of service. J. Grid Comput. 14(1), 5–22 (2016)CrossRef Tchernykh, A., Lozano, L., Schwiegelshohn, U., Bouvry, P., Pecero, J.E., Nesmachnow, S., Drozdov, A.Y.: Online bi-objective scheduling for IaaS clouds ensuring quality of service. J. Grid Comput. 14(1), 5–22 (2016)CrossRef
23.
go back to reference Tchernykh, A., Pecero, J.E., Barrondo, A., Schaeffer, E.: Adaptive energy efficient scheduling in peer-to-peer desktop grids. Future Gener. Comput. Syst. 36, 209–220 (2014). Special Section: Intelligent Big Data Processing. Special Section: Behavior Data Security Issues in Network Information Propagation. Special Section: Energy-Efficiency in Large Distributed Computing Architectures. Special Section: eScience Infrastructure and ApplicationsCrossRef Tchernykh, A., Pecero, J.E., Barrondo, A., Schaeffer, E.: Adaptive energy efficient scheduling in peer-to-peer desktop grids. Future Gener. Comput. Syst. 36, 209–220 (2014). Special Section: Intelligent Big Data Processing. Special Section: Behavior Data Security Issues in Network Information Propagation. Special Section: Energy-Efficiency in Large Distributed Computing Architectures. Special Section: eScience Infrastructure and ApplicationsCrossRef
Metadata
Title
A Security-Driven Approach to Online Job Scheduling in IaaS Cloud Computing Systems
Authors
Jakub Gąsior
Franciszek Seredyński
Andrei Tchernykh
Copyright Year
2018
DOI
https://doi.org/10.1007/978-3-319-78054-2_15

Premium Partner